Output 89bcfdb715f9c72a30f05b3c032e018fc2ecb6c5e8fe18f49d0e27869353bbf1:27

value
1553987
script pubkey
OP_0 OP_PUSHBYTES_20 7ef13d6161ee23ba65995d95544fefe2e7a2a6dc
address
bc1q0mcn6ctpac3m5evetk24gnl0utn69fkuysj9cy
transaction
89bcfdb715f9c72a30f05b3c032e018fc2ecb6c5e8fe18f49d0e27869353bbf1
spent
true